I don't understand this analysis. First of all, in the USA McDonalds
has only 12,300 locations. Secondly, according to the existing IPv6
policy, if McDonalds were to go to an ISP and ask for IPv6 connectivity
for their network of 12,300 restaurants, the ISP would assign them 12,300
/48 address blocks. That is the policy and if you don't understand why
each location qualifies for a /48 then you need to do some study on the
fundamentals of IPv6 addressing.
